Does anyone know if the Ezonics EZDual Cam is CPiA based? I'm trying to
get it to work with RH 7.1 (2.4.2-2 kernel) with the cpia-1.2 drivers
with no luck. I've compiled the kernel with Video for linux and so forth
(following a post from linuxnewbie.org about cpia based cams) and got
the drivers to compile but when I insmod cpia.o I get:

kernel: V4L-Driver for Vision CPiA based cameras v1.2.0
modprobe: modprobe: Can't locate module cpia_usb

then I do insmod cpia_usb.o:

kernel: usb.c: registered new driver cpia

I run ./gqcam and get:
/dev/video: No such device

and from the kernel:

modprobe: modprobe: Can't locate module char-major-81-0

I had a /dev/video already but it was a directory and when I ran gqcam
it said /dev/video: Is a directory. Duh. So I moved that and created a
hard link to /dev/video0 (why, I don't know, I was way over my head at
this point). It seems like I'm just missing something small but I don't
know what. Should there be some info about V4L loading somewhere? I'm
lost. Help!
